About
Dr. Ravindra Kumar Gupta earned his Ph.D. degree in physics (Solid State Ionics) in 1997 from the Pandit Ravishankar Shukla University, Raipur, India. He studied the electrical properties and battery characteristics of some composite electrolytes. He opted to continue his research work for developing superionic solids in composite, glass, and polymeric phases for solid-state electrochemical devices, such as batteries, polymer electrolyte membrane fuel cells, solid oxide fuel cells, and dye-sensitized solar cells. Currently, he is working as an associate professor at the King Abdullah Institute for Nanotechnology, King Saud University, Riyadh, Saudi Arabia.
